The Bankers Association of Trinidad and Tobago currently comprises eight member banks.

ANSA Bank opened to the public on April 6, 2021, through the acquisition of 100% of the shares of Bank of Baroda (Trinidad and Tobago) Limited by ANSA Merchant Bank Limited.

CIBC FirstCaribbean is a major Caribbean bank offering a full range of market-leading financial services in Corporate Banking, Retail Banking, Wealth Management, Credit Cards, Treasury Sales and Trading, and Investment Banking. It is the largest, regionally-listed bank in the English-and Dutch speaking Caribbean. The bank has over 3,400 staff; 69 branches, 22 banking centres, and seven offices in 17 regional markets.

Citi has been in Trinidad & Tobago since 1965, and has built solid, long lasting and mutually beneficial relationships with its clients in the public and private sectors, with other financial institutions, and with local communities.

RBC Royal Bank Limited has a long and impressive history in Trinidad and Tobago, dating back to 1902. It is one of the country’s leading banks and operates 25 branches, complemented by a large network of ATMs, and supported by automated telephone and internet banking services.

Since 1954 Scotiabank has been serving the people of Trinidad and Tobago, providing financial products and services. We currently have a network of 24 branches and 5 sales centres strategically located across Trinidad and Tobago, designed to offer the latest financial service and advice to existing and potential customers.
